Technological Innovations Transforming Animal Breeding
The Animal Genetics Market is currently experiencing a technological renaissance. The days of relying solely on visual, phenotypic observation to select breeding stock are long gone. Today, the industry is driven by cutting-edge molecular biology, big data analytics, and advanced reproductive technologies, all of which are fundamentally reshaping how animals are bred, managed, and traded globally.
The engine behind this transformation is the tireless work of professional animal geneticists. These experts are leveraging high-throughput DNA sequencing and CRISPR-Cas9 gene-editing technologies to pinpoint exact genetic markers linked to complex biological traits. For instance, advanced gene editing has allowed scientists to breed pigs that are highly resilient to Porcine Reproductive and Respiratory Syndrome (PRRS), a disease that historically cost the global swine industry billions. Consequently, global genetics markets have seen a massive influx of capital directed toward biotechnology startups and established agricultural firms pushing these boundaries.

This technological wave is particularly visible in the bovine industry. Today, cattle genetic testing companies routinely utilize Single Nucleotide Polymorphism (SNP) arrays to analyze thousands of genetic variants simultaneously. When these testing firms collaborate with major animal breeding companies, the results are transformative. They can successfully breed cattle that produce higher milk yields while simultaneously exhibiting enhanced resistance to endemic diseases like mastitis. As machine learning begins to process these massive genomic datasets, the accuracy of breeding value predictions will continue to soar.
